When should the brake pads be changed in a Ford S-Max?

I just bought a used Ford S-Max and I'm wondering when I should change the brake pads. The current mileage is 50,000 and I'm not sure if the previous owner had changed them recently. Is there a specific mileage or warning sign that I should look out for?

Brake pads should typically be changed every 30,000-50,000 miles, so it might be a good idea to have them checked by a mechanic at your next oil change or maintenance appointment. It's better to be proactive and replace them before they wear out completely.

If you notice any squeaking or grinding noises when you brake, that's a sign that your brake pads are worn out and need to be replaced as soon as possible. It's always best to err on the side of caution and have them checked by a professional mechanic.

You can also visually inspect your brake pads to see if they have at least ¼ inch of pad material left. If they look thin or worn down, it's time for a replacement. And remember, always replace all four pads at the same time for even wear.
